Woman arrested in Silver Springs after car chase

Robert Perea, The Fernley Reporter

A woman was arrested Sunday evening following a car chase that started in Mineral County and ended when her car was disabled by Nevada Highway Patrol troopers in Silver Springs.

According to the Lyon County Sheriff’s Office, Michelle Bobb, 36, of Schurz, was arrested on a felony charge of eluding an officer and suspicion of driving under the influence. No one was injured in the incident.

At 8:08 p.m. Sunday, Lyon County Dispatch received a call from Mineral County requesting assistance in stopping a vehicle coming into Yerington that had failed to yield. The incident became a pursuit, as the vehicle headed northbound on U.S. 95A at speeds approaching 100 miles an hour.

The pursuit ended when the Nevada Highway Patrol assisted by placing spike strips on the highway as the vehicle came into Silver Springs. The vehicle had all four tires flattened and came to a stop on 5th Street in Silver Springs. Bobb was arrested without incident.
